Research is your most powerful tool when buying a used car. Before visiting any dealership, research market values for the models you're interested in and check vehicle history reports to avoid potential problems. Compare similar vehicles, read owner reviews, and create a shortlist of models with strong reliability ratings. This preparation gives you negotiating power and helps you recognize a good deal when you see one.

What to Bring on Your Test Drive
Always bring your driver's license, insurance information, and a checklist of features to evaluate when test-driving a used car in Plattsmouth. These essentials ensure a smooth dealership experience.

Your test driving checklist should include notes about comfort, visibility, acceleration, braking, and technology features. Consider bringing a friend for an objective second opinion, and don't forget to take photos of any concerns you notice during your inspection.
How to Properly Test Drive a Used Car
A proper test drive involves more than a quick spin around the block. Drive on different road types, test all functions possible, and pay attention to how the vehicle handles and sounds.

Start by adjusting seats and mirrors to your preference, then drive at various speeds on both city streets and highways if possible. Test the brakes firmly when it's safe to do so, check for unusual noises, and evaluate how the transmission shifts. Inspection Tips Before Making Your Decision
Never skip a pre-purchase inspection when buying a used car from a dealer in the Plattsmouth area. Check for uneven tire wear, fluid leaks, any smoke from the tailpipe when it starts up, and functioning electronics.Look under the hood for signs of damage or poor maintenance, and examine the interior for excessive wear. Test every button, switch, and feature.
